As nouns, sexual desire is a hypernym of sensualism; that is, sexual desire is a word with a broader meaning than sensualism:
  • sensualism: desire for sensual pleasures
  • sexual desire: a desire for sexual intimacy
Other hypernyms of sensualism include concupiscence, eros, physical attraction.
